The Gradual Revelation
Most hint systems within these digital tombs do not offer immediate and complete solutions. Instead, they unfold in layers, gradually revealing the path forward. The first hint might offer a subtle nudge, a redirection of focus towards a forgotten clue. Subsequent hints delve deeper, exposing key elements of the puzzle’s solution, bit by bit. This graduated approach preserves the player’s sense of agency, allowing them to maintain intellectual engagement while gently guiding them toward the answer. Ciphers and Substitution
Certain chambers presented direct cryptographic challenges, classic ciphers disguised within the digital framework. Caesar ciphers shifted the alphabet, Vigenre squares encrypted messages with keys, and substitution ciphers swapped symbols for letters. The successful digital archaeologist possessed not only linguistic skills, but also a working knowledge of cryptographic principles, capable of breaking down these encrypted messages and revealing their hidden meanings.
